Hi,

I’ve submitted an update to the MNA framework document.  In this revision:

- We’ve updated terminology to reference the definitions found in the MNA requirements draft.
- Added text to allow a solution to provide local remapping of bit catalogs.
- Added several clarifications to section 2 (Structure).
- Editorial changes.

> Abstract:
>   This document specifies an architectural framework for the MPLS
>   Network Actions (MNA) technologies.  MNA technologies are used to
>   indicate actions for Label Switched Paths (LSPs) and/or MPLS packets
>   and to transfer data needed for these actions.
> 
>   The document describes a common set of network actions and
>   information elements supporting additional operational models and
>   capabilities of MPLS networks.  Some of these actions are defined in
>   existing MPLS specifications, while others require extensions to
>   existing specifications to meet the requirements found in
>   "Requirements for MPLS Network Action Indicators and Ancillary Data".
